    Recently my CF18 does the blue screen crash randomly (with no action on my part) it can go for weeks then it does it. Hot or cold, no difference. I used the microsoft details about the crash but it always says it is unable to determine the cause. No new software and only updates from microsoft (XP Pro SP3) It started this about 6 months ago. My local pc expert passed away and I have not found anyone who has a clue.
    Any ideas very welcome,
    Thank you, Fred

    Your problem sounds familiar and if it is anything like what we have experienced it will only get progressively worse leading to complete failure. We tried all the usual fixes ie, remove/subsitute ram, hdd, bios battery, reset bios etc. I had mentioned all this in an earlier post on CF-18 failure modes. I don't know your model number, but from our experience the 1.2g (Mk4 & 5) models are the most unreliable of all the CF-18 models.
